Standard-Related Information
ASTM G48 Pitting and Crevice Corrosion Testing is a widely recognized laboratory test for evaluating the corrosion resistance of metals in various environments. This testing service is governed by international and national standards, including ASTM (American Society for Testing and Materials), ISO (International Organization for Standardization), EN (European Committee for Standardization), TSE (Turkish Standards Institution), and others.
Why this Test is Needed
The need for ASTM G48 Pitting and Crevice Corrosion Testing arises from the importance of ensuring product safety, reliability, and quality. This test helps manufacturers to evaluate the corrosion resistance of their products, which is critical in industries such as aerospace, automotive, chemical processing, construction, and others.
